diff --git a/libpsn00b/include/elf.h b/libpsn00b/include/elf.h new file mode 100644 index 0000000..b4c4408 --- /dev/null +++ b/libpsn00b/include/elf.h @@ -0,0 +1,138 @@ +/* + * PSn00bSDK dynamic linker + * (C) 2021 spicyjpeg - MPL licensed + * + * This file is used internally by the dynamic linker to parse the "header" + * (.dynamic and .dynsym sections) of dynamically-linked libraries built with + * the provided linker script. Most of it is copied from the standard Unix + * elf.h header, with the only changes being removed typedefs and #defines + * converted to enums. + */ + +#ifndef __ELF_H +#define __ELF_H + +#include <sys/types.h> + +typedef enum { + DT_NULL = 0, /* Marks end of dynamic section */ + DT_NEEDED = 1, /* Name of needed library */ + DT_PLTRELSZ = 2, /* Size in bytes of PLT relocs */ + DT_PLTGOT = 3, /* Processor defined value */ + DT_HASH = 4, /* Address of symbol hash table */ + DT_STRTAB = 5, /* Address of string table */ + DT_SYMTAB = 6, /* Address of symbol table */ + DT_RELA = 7, /* Address of Rela relocs */ + DT_RELASZ = 8, /* Total size of Rela relocs */ + DT_RELAENT = 9, /* Size of one Rela reloc */ + DT_STRSZ = 10, /* Size of string table */ + DT_SYMENT = 11, /* Size of one symbol table entry */ + DT_INIT = 12, /* Address of init function */ + DT_FINI = 13, /* Address of termination function */ + DT_SONAME = 14, /* Name of shared object */ + DT_RPATH = 15, /* Library search path (deprecated) */ + DT_SYMBOLIC = 16, /* Start symbol search here */ + DT_REL = 17, /* Address of Rel relocs */ + DT_RELSZ = 18, /* Total size of Rel relocs */ + DT_RELENT = 19, /* Size of one Rel reloc */ + DT_PLTREL = 20, /* Type of reloc in PLT */ + DT_DEBUG = 21, /* For debugging; unspecified */ + DT_TEXTREL = 22, /* Reloc might modify .text */ + DT_JMPREL = 23, /* Address of PLT relocs */ + DT_BIND_NOW = 24, /* Process relocations of object */ + DT_INIT_ARRAY = 25, /* Array with addresses of init fct */ + DT_FINI_ARRAY = 26, /* Array with addresses of fini fct */ + DT_INIT_ARRAYSZ = 27, /* Size in bytes of DT_INIT_ARRAY */ + DT_FINI_ARRAYSZ = 28, /* Size in bytes of DT_FINI_ARRAY */ + DT_RUNPATH = 29, /* Library search path */ + DT_FLAGS = 30, /* Flags for the object being loaded */ + DT_ENCODING = 32, /* Start of encoded range */ + DT_PREINIT_ARRAY = 32, /* Array with addresses of preinit fct*/ + DT_PREINIT_ARRAYSZ = 33, /* size in bytes of DT_PREINIT_ARRAY */ + DT_SYMTAB_SHNDX = 34, /* Address of SYMTAB_SHNDX section */ + DT_NUM = 35, /* Number used */ + DT_LOOS = 0x6000000d, /* Start of OS-specific */ + DT_HIOS = 0x6ffff000, /* End of OS-specific */ + DT_LOPROC = 0x70000000, /* Start of processor-specific */ + DT_HIPROC = 0x7fffffff, /* End of processor-specific */ + + DT_MIPS_RLD_VERSION = 0x70000001, + DT_MIPS_FLAGS = 0x70000005, + DT_MIPS_BASE_ADDRESS = 0x70000006, + DT_MIPS_LOCAL_GOTNO = 0x7000000a, + DT_MIPS_SYMTABNO = 0x70000011, + DT_MIPS_UNREFEXTNO = 0x70000012, + DT_MIPS_GOTSYM = 0x70000013, + DT_MIPS_HIPAGENO = 0x70000014 +} Elf32_d_tag; + +typedef enum { + RHF_NONE = 0, /* No flags */ + RHF_QUICKSTART = 1, /* Use quickstart */ + RHF_NOTPOT = 2, /* Hash size not power of 2 */ + RHF_NO_LIBRARY_REPLACEMENT = 4 /* Ignore LD_LIBRARY_PATH */ +} Elf32_d_MIPS_FLAGS; + +typedef struct { + Elf32_d_tag d_tag; /* Dynamic entry type */ + union { + uint32_t d_val; /* Integer value */ + void *d_ptr; /* Address value */ + } d_un; +} Elf32_Dyn; + +typedef struct { + uint32_t st_name; /* Symbol name (string tbl index) */ + void *st_value; /* Symbol value */ + size_t st_size; /* Symbol size */ + uint8_t st_info; /* Symbol type and binding */ + uint8_t st_other; /* Symbol visibility */ + uint16_t st_shndx; /* Section index */ +} Elf32_Sym; + +#define ELF32_ST_BIND(val) ((Elf32_st_bind) (((uint8_t) (val)) >> 4)) +#define ELF32_ST_TYPE(val) ((Elf32_st_type) ((val) & 0xf)) +#define ELF32_ST_INFO(bind, type) ((((uint8_t) (bind)) << 4) + (((uint8_t) (type)) & 0xf)) + +typedef enum { + STB_LOCAL = 0, /* Local symbol */ + STB_GLOBAL = 1, /* Global symbol */ + STB_WEAK = 2, /* Weak symbol */ + STB_NUM = 3, /* Number of defined types. */ + STB_LOOS = 10, /* Start of OS-specific */ + STB_GNU_UNIQUE = 10, /* Unique symbol. */ + STB_HIOS = 12, /* End of OS-specific */ + STB_LOPROC = 13, /* Start of processor-specific */ + STB_HIPROC = 15 /* End of processor-specific */ +} Elf32_st_bind; + +typedef enum { + STT_NOTYPE = 0, /* Symbol type is unspecified */ + STT_OBJECT = 1, /* Symbol is a data object */ + STT_FUNC = 2, /* Symbol is a code object */ + STT_SECTION = 3, /* Symbol associated with a section */ + STT_FILE = 4, /* Symbol's name is file name */ + STT_COMMON = 5, /* Symbol is a common data object */ + STT_TLS = 6, /* Symbol is thread-local data object*/ + STT_NUM = 7, /* Number of defined types. */ + STT_LOOS = 10, /* Start of OS-specific */ + STT_GNU_IFUNC = 10, /* Symbol is indirect code object */ + STT_HIOS = 12, /* End of OS-specific */ + STT_LOPROC = 13, /* Start of processor-specific */ + STT_HIPROC = 15 /* End of processor-specific */ +} Elf32_st_type; + +// If you need to add more constants, you may use the following Python snippet +// to quickly convert #defines to enums: +/* +import re +t = """<paste #defines here>""" +t = re.sub( + r"(0x[0-9a-f]+|0b[01]+|[0-9]+)", + lambda m: f"= {m.group(1)},", + t.replace("#define ", "\t").replace("#define\t", "\t") +) +print("typedef enum {\n" + t + "\n} NAME;") +*/ + +#endif |
